Pink Sangria
10 servings
30 minutes

The combination of juicy watermelon flesh, refreshing lime, and sweet orange liqueur gives the drink a rich, fruity flavor with a hint of citrus tartness. Cane sugar enhances the natural sweetness of the fruits, while pink dry wine and lemonade create a balance between freshness and fizz. 1
Cut the watermelon and lime into thin slices and place them in a pitcher. Add sugar and orange liqueur. Mix and let sit at room temperature for 30 minutes.
- Lime: 2 pieces
- Cane sugar: 2 tablespoons
- Watermelon pulp: 500 g
- Orange liqueur: 160 ml
2
Add wine and lemonade, mix gently, and pour into glasses.
- Dry pink wine: 1.5 l
- Lemonade: 1.25 l
